Crane
For our Bird Day, we met a bird keeper at the East African Crane exhibit and learned all about this beautiful species. We then played a game using chopsticks to try to pick up plastic ants, which taught us how the crane uses its beak to eat insects. We also met an education staff member who showed us how to candle eggs, and we held the baby chicks! We played a game and made a crane craft, too. |
